**Audit Item 4.2 — Firmware Update Channel Verification.** For all Brellock HomeSense devices, confirm the update channel is pinned to the signed production feed and not a staging mirror. New team members: check that the channel manifest is signed, that rollback protection is enabled, and that the last three releases show matching checksums in the Verity console. Record any mismatch before proceeding; do not push updates until verified. Questions on this item should go to the channel owner.

signatory, kaweg-fawig: Zorys Druys Jorius Novael

## Marlowe Functions — Environments

Support note: cold starts on the Marlowe serverless handlers add 2–4 seconds to the first request after idle. Prod keeps two warm instances; staging keeps none, so slow first responses there are expected and not a bug. If customers report repeated slow requests within a minute, escalate — that's not a cold start. The warm-pool behavior is governed by the following values.

settings of fafog-haduf:
ZORIX_PIN=4648
ZORIX_METRICS_HOST=metrics.zorix.paliqsys.corp
ZORIX_LOG_LEVEL=info
ZORIX_TENANT=druix

# Heatherfield Clinic reminder job settings.
# New team members: this job runs every evening at 21:00 and sends
# next-day appointment reminders. Do not change the send window without
# approval from the scheduling lead, as patients opted into that slot.
# Retries are capped at three. The job reads appointments via the
# connection defined directly below.

warehouse DSN: mssql://rusdor_svc:0FSWCn9@db-951a.paliqforge.local:5432/ulawyn

**Ticket DEPBOT-203: Deploy-status bot leaks environment names**

For security review. The Orrin deploy-status chat bot replies in any channel it's invited to, including shared guest channels, and its responses include internal environment names and rollout percentages. No auth check on the status command. Proposed fix: restrict responses to an allowlisted channel set and strip environment detail for non-members. No evidence of external access yet, but log review is pending. Repro confirmed against the candidate build recorded below.

build token for fahap-yagag: htk3_d09